Descendants of Edmon 'Eddy' Mabe

Generation No. 2


2. SAMUEL NELSON5 MABE (EDMON 'EDDY'4, REUBEN3, JOHN2, WILLIAM1) was born October 18, 1836 in Stokes County, North Carolina, and died June 26, 1922 in Edmundson County, Kentucky. He married (1) MARTHA JANE BREWER Abt. 1855 in Hawkins County, Tennessee. She was born October 02, 1837 in Sullivan County, Tennessee, and died November 07, 1902 in Claiborne County, Tennessee. He married (2) NANCY JANE WILKERSON August 09, 1897 in Edmundson County, Kentucky, daughter of FATHER WILKENS and MOTHER MARTIN. She was born December 31, 1848 in Kentucky, and died January 05, 1940 in Fresno, California.

  vii.   DANIEL CHESTER MABE, b. December 31, 1870, Laurel County, Kentucky; d. September 22, 1955, Middlesboro Hospital, Bell County, Kentucky; m. (1) WIFE UNKNOWN, Abt. 1891; m. (2) JANE FULLER, Abt. 1910, Claiborne County, Tennessee; b. Abt. 1895, Tennessee.
  Notes for DANIEL CHESTER MABE:

The 1900 State Penitentiary, Virginia census:
Mabe, Daniel (Dec 1873)

The 1910 Claiborne County, Tennessee census:
Dan and his wife Jane living with his brother Gilbert.

Daniel Mabe -- Sept. 29, 1955

Daniel Chester Mabe, age 85, passed away in a Middlesboro Hospital September 22, 1955.

Survivors: wife Mrs. Jane Mabe, Lone Mountain; brothers Gilbert Mabe, Monroe, Michigan, Tom and Sam Mabe, Lone Mountain.

Funeral services were held 1:00 p.m. Saturday at the Coffey Funeral Home Chapel with Rev. Howard Smith officiating.

  More About DANIEL CHESTER MABE:
Burial: September 24, 1955, Greer Cemetery, Claiborne County, Tennessee

  ix.   SAMUEL NELSON MABE, JR, b. February 29, 1876, Hancock County, Tennessee; d. January 26, 1959, Claiborne County, Tennessee; m. (1) LOU CREDA HOBBS, Abt. 1897; b. July 28, 1860, Kentucky; d. January 12, 1924, Claiborne County, Tennessee; m. (2) NANNIE MULLINS, Abt. 1928; b. Abt. 1878, Kentucky; d. May 14, 1959, Claiborne County, Tennessee.
  Notes for SAMUEL NELSON MABE, JR:

The 1900 Claiborne County, Tennessee census:
Mabe, Sam (Feb 1876), L. (Dec 1857), Maggie Eldridge (May 1887 stepchild), and Lizzie (Aug 1888)

The 1910 Claiborne County, Tennessee census:
Mabe, Sam (54), Loai (50) 8 children 8 alive, Lizzie Eldridge (18 stepchild) 1 child 1 alive, Sam Eldridge (3 Lizzie's son), and Ida (7 step grandchild), Jordon, Enoch (19 no relation). Sam and Loai were married 12 yrs. Occupation:farming. It says that Lizzie was married for a year and that this was Loai's second marriage. Loai, Lizzie and all their parents were born in Kentucky. Ida and her father was born in Virginia. Ida's mother was born in Kentucky. Sam was born in Tennessee. Everyone else and their parents were born in Tennessee. Sam was living next door to his brother John.

The 1920 Claiborne County, Tennessee census:
Mabe, Samuel N. (49) and Lucretia (60) living with his son-in-law Enoch Jordon. Enoch (28) was married to Lizzie (28). Their children Sam (12), Alford (5), and Bill (3yrs 7 mos.) were living with them.


Sam Mabe --- Feb. 5, 1959

Mr. Sam Mabe, age 82, passed away in a Knoxville Hospital January 26, 1959.

Survivors: wife, Mrs, Nannie Mabe, Lone Mountain; one brother, Mr. Tom Mabe, Lone Mountain.

Funeral service was held 2:00 p.m. Wednesday at the Lone Mountain Methodist church with Rev. M. Lathum officiating.

Interment in the Leabow Cemetery.

Pallbearers: Buddy Leabow, Hobert Leabow, Frank Lane, Granville Hodge, Clay Jordon, and Jim Jordon.

Coffey in charge.

  More About SAMUEL NELSON MABE, JR:
Burial: Leabow Cemetery, Claiborne County, Tennessee
Occupation: Farming
